Gaudet’s Auto Body Islanders catcher Logan Gallant throws the ball to third base after a member of the Fredericton Royals struck out during a New Brunswick Senior Baseball League game at Memorial Field in June. The teams split a pair of games in New Brunswick on July 23. The Islanders host the Moncton Fisher Cats on July 26 at 7:30 p.m. Jason Simmonds/The Guardian - Jason Simmonds • The GuardianThe P.E.I.

Islanders assistant coach Chuck Grady said there is a good rivalry between the Islanders and Fisher Cats. Grady noted that with the teams close geographically, they play single games against each other rather than doubleheaders. This, Grady went on to say, results in each team able to field their best lineups.

“Two wins could distance us a little bit,” said Islanders head coach Kevin MacLean. “In the league overall, there is a lot of parity in it. These are two key games.” “In big situations, we are not stranding too many runners,” said Gallant. “Our pitching and defence, we know what we are going to get out of them night in and night out. The offence has always been our biggest issue, and that’s one thing that has been on a roll lately.”
